Месяц: Март 2020

  • Простой rpm репозиторий используя Inotify и webdav

    от автора

    В этом посте рассмотрим хранилище rpm артефактов c помощью простого скрипта с inotify + createrepo. Заливка артефактов осуществляется через webdav используя apache httpd. Почему apache httpd будет написано ближе к концу поста. Итак, решение должно отвечать cледующим требованиям для организации только RPM хранилища: Бесплатное Доступность пакета в репозитории через несколько секунд после загрузки в хранилище…

  • Используем Kata Containers в Kubernetes

    от автора

    Данная статья продолжает тему с Kata Containers, поднятую в прошлый раз. Сегодня я буду настраивать Kubernetes для работы с Kata Containers.

  • Основные ошибки при составлении CV начинающими IT специалистами

    от автора

    Многие начинающие IT специалисты, после получения начальных профессональных знаний, составляют CV и идут его рассылать по рекрутерам. Но мало кто из них задумывается о том, что CV это его лицо в глазах человека, принимающего решения. И большинство делает одни и те же ошибки, способные отодвинуть их резюме вниз списка. Ниже я расскажу какие ошибки видел…

  • Логистика. Введение. Просто о сложном

    от автора

    Все мы любим мечтать, в особенности когда это связано с посещением новых мест или возвращением в любимые места. Ничто так не воодушевляет, как чувство предвкушения планируемого события и омрачает его лишь наличие организационных моментов, в частности выбор и покупка билетов на самолет. И почему-то внутренне мы всегда откладываем этот вопрос или перекладываем на туроператов, метапоисковики…

  • Расстановка точек над датчиками газа серии MQ – глубокое понимание и настройка

    от автора

    После покупки копеечного датчика утечки газа появилось желание разобрать все по полочкам и узнать, что происходит внутри. Информации и статей по датчикам очень много, но большинство ограничено распиновкой стандартного китайского модуля, иногда принципов работы. Про относительно точное определение абсолютных значений информации нет. Забегая наперед скажу, что мы попробуем выжать все из даташита, включая: точные функции…

  • Организация интранета (автоматизация ИТ-продакшена). Часть 1 — Пользователи и почта

    от автора

    Рано или поздно у любой ИТ компании (аутсорс или продуктовой) возникает желание организовать собственное пространство, где можно хранить информацию по проектам, сотрудникам, продажам. Вести рабочую переписку и обсуждать задачи/стратегии/документы. Чаще всего, такие компании начинают кодить все сами или пилят что-то для Битрикс24 и тд. В данной серии статей я расскажу о нашем велосипеде — опыте…

  • DevOps для разработчиков (или против них?!)

    от автора

    Подход DevOps качественно изменил процесс разработки. Если раньше программисты только писали код и прогоняли тесты, то теперь они участвуют и в развертывании проектов на продакшен. Звучит так, будто сисадмины решили переложить свои заботы на плечи разработчиков, не так ли? Но не все так просто. Выяснить это решил Барух Садогурский (jbaruch) из JFrog. Под катом вы…

  • Пластмассовый выстрел: атипичные патроны

    от автора

    Полимерные патроны — технология, в которую американские военные вкладывают деньги больше 60 лет. Она породила одни из самых безумных экспериментальных боеприпасов в истории оружия и одни из самых перспективных. Как были устроены U-образные, плоские и «треугольные» патроны? Почему некоторые, казалось бы, очевидные инженерные решения не удается внедрить более полувека? Ответы на эти вопросы, фотографии и…

  • Как мы находим неочевидные ошибки в интерфейсах онлайн-заданий для детей

    от автора

    Каждый новый урок на платформе — это плод совместного труда методистов, дизайнеров, иллюстраторов, программистов и тестировщиков. Новые задания обычно проходят тестирование в школах, где методисты могут пронаблюдать, насколько они понятны ученикам, собрать отзывы и обратную связь. Но некоторые проблемы на малых выборках могут остаться незамеченными. И здесь приходит на помощь изучение детальных действий учеников —…

  • Как мы обеспечивали рост Ситимобила

    от автора

    Меня зовут Иван, я руководитель серверной разработки в Ситимобил. Сегодня я расскажу о том, что собой представляет эта самая серверная разработка, с какими проблемами мы сталкивались и как планируем развиваться.